Find the length of the radius of a sphere with a surface area of 5541.77 cm2.

The area of a sphere: A  = 4.π.R²

A= 5541.77 → 5541.77 = 4.π.R²

R² = (5541.77)/(4.π)
R² = 441; → R =√441; R = 21 cm
